Role Overview: We are looking for a detail-oriented and organised Credit & Deal Workshopping Admin to support brokers with the administrative side of lender workshopping. This is a structured, process-driven role focused on data entry, document and deal packaging, lender workshopping, tracking and CRM updates. You will not be responsible for making lending decisions, originating deals, or negotiating credit policy exceptions.
This is a newly created offshore role, offering the opportunity to help establish efficient processes as the business grows. You’ll work closely with brokers and leadership, with potential progression as the offshore function expands.
Key Responsibilities:
- Monitor Slack for new deal workshopping requests from brokers.
- Review deal breakdowns, bank statement analysis and client information.
- Enter deal details accurately into lender quoting and assessment platforms.
- Review indicative lender outcomes, including serviceability, likely approval and pricing.
- Prepare concise deal summaries and email lender BDMs where required.
- Consolidate lender responses into clear summaries for brokers.
- Track deals and follow up on outstanding lender responses to ensure same-day turnaround.
- Maintain accurate workshopping records and update Lend and GoHighLevel.
- Respond to broker status queries and flag lender delays, declines or system issues.
- Adapt to new lender platforms and support process improvements as the business grows.
